Juniper is an ayurvedic berry and a very widespread remedial tree. It has the widest bodily range of any woody plant it ranges all through North America, Europe, and Asia. We supply our frequent juniper berry joint pain relief physique oil for curb soreness, body ache, pain, and inflammation.


This plant is included with sharply spiked needles, bears chubby inexperienced fruit with the characteristic, star-shaped feature. They are harvested manually through the cautious beating of the fruit-laden branches. The ripe berries are then gathered and the unripe berries are left for the subsequent year’s harvest. They are then dried, unfold out over mats. Distillation of the berries offers an imperative oil with a balsamic, woody heady scent better via an adhesive word of pine needles.
